WD-40 (NASDAQ:WDFC) CFO Purchases $57,044.48 in Stock

WD-40 (NASDAQ:WDFC - Get Free Report) CFO Sara Kathleen Hyzer bought 256 shares of the company's st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, April 11th. The shares were bought at an average cost of $222.83 per share, for a total transaction of $57,044.48. Following the transaction, the chief financial officer now directly owns 4,072 shares of the company's stock, valued at $907,363.76. This trade represents a 6.71 % increase in their position. WD-40 (NASDAQ:WDFC -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, April 8th. The specialty chemicals company reported $1.32 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.27 by $0.05. The company had revenue of $146.10 million during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$154.40 million. WD-40 had a return on equity of 31.68% and a net margin of 11.78%.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 5.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the firm earned $1.14 EPS. On average, research analysts expect that WD-40 will post 5.42 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

WD-40 Announces Dividend




The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, April 30th. Investors of record on Friday, April 18th will be issued a $0.94 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, April 17th. This represents a $3.76 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.70%. WD-40's dividend payout ratio is presently 59.97%.

About WD-40

WD-40 Company develops and sells maintenance products, and homecare and cleaning products in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. The company provides multi-purpose maintenance products that include aerosol sprays, non-aerosol trigger sprays, precision pens, and in liquid-bulk form products under the WD-40 Multi-Use brand name; specialty maintenance products, such as penetrants, degreasers, corrosion inhibitors, greases, lubricants, and rust removers under the WD-40 Specialist brand; and bike-specific products.
